最近是不是遇到过这种情况?你正美滋滋地准备更新自己的网站,或者有客户跟你反馈说,怎么你的独立站突然就打不开了,页面一片空白,或者显示一个冷冰冰的错误提示。是不是瞬间就有点头大,心里咯噔一下?别着急,这几乎是每个做独立站的朋友都会碰到的问题,哪怕是经验丰富的老手也不例外。今天咱们就来好好唠唠,当你的独立站“罢工”时,可以从哪几个方向入手,一步步把它给“修”好。
首先,咱得放平心态。网站打不开,不一定就是你做错了什么。这背后涉及的因素太多了,就像一个精密的机器,任何一个环节的小故障都可能导致最终结果出问题。所以,咱们先别急着否定自己,更别慌。把它看作一个解谜游戏,咱们一步步来。
这个操作虽然简单,但超级重要。你自己打不开,可能是因为你的网络、你的电脑设置,甚至是你浏览器的缓存出了问题。这时候,你可以:
*换个浏览器试试:比如你平时用Chrome,可以试试用Edge或者Safari打开看看。
*用手机流量访问:断开Wi-Fi,用手机的4G/5G网络访问一下,这能帮你判断是不是本地网络的问题。
*让朋友帮忙看看:把链接发给在不同城市、用不同网络的朋友,问问他们能不能正常打开。
如果别人都能打开,只有你不行,那问题大概率出在你的本地环境,解决起来就容易多了,清理一下浏览器缓存或者重启下路由器可能就好了。
如果经过上一步确认,是网站本身出了问题,那咱们就得把目光投向几个关键的地方了。我习惯把建站想象成开一家实体店,这样理解起来更直观。
你的网站需要一个存放所有文件和数据的地方,这就是服务器(也叫主机)。你还需要一个让顾客能找到你的地址,这就是域名。这俩出问题,店铺直接就“消失”了。
*服务器(主机)宕机或资源耗尽:这就好比你的店铺所在的商场停电了,或者你的店铺面积太小,一下涌进来太多客人,直接把门给挤爆了。这时候,你需要联系你的主机服务商,看看是不是服务器出现了故障,或者你的网站流量是不是突然暴增,超出了套餐限制。
*域名解析(DNS)问题:这就像你的店铺地址(域名)在导航地图上(DNS服务器)被标错了,或者地图更新延迟了。顾客按照地址找过来,结果发现是家包子铺。你可以用一些在线的“DNS查询工具”查一下,看看你的域名是不是正常解析到了正确的服务器IP地址上。
*SSL证书过期:现在浏览器对安全要求很高,如果你的网站SSL证书(就是网址前面那个小锁头)过期了,浏览器可能会直接拦截访问,并提示“不安全”。定期检查并续费证书很关键。
如果“地基”没问题,那可能就是你的“店铺装修”——也就是网站程序本身出了岔子。
*主题或插件冲突:这是最常见的原因之一。尤其是当你更新了WordPress(或者其他建站程序)的核心版本、某个主题或者插件之后,突然网站就白屏了。这通常是因为新版本和旧的某个插件不兼容,打起来了。解决思路是,通过主机商提供的文件管理器,进入网站文件的根目录,把最近安装或更新的插件/主题文件夹暂时改名(比如在文件夹名后面加个 `_old`),这样网站程序就识别不到它了,通常会恢复正常。然后你再逐一排查是哪个惹的祸。
*.htaccess文件错误:这个文件是Apache服务器的一个配置文件,有时候规则写错了,也会导致整个网站无法访问。同样可以通过文件管理器,把这个文件暂时改名(比如改成 `.htaccess_old`),看网站是否恢复。
*代码错误:如果你或者开发人员最近修改了网站的某些核心代码(比如 `functions.php` 文件),一个标点符号的错误都可能导致全站崩溃。这时候,就需要用修改前的备份文件去覆盖恢复。
*遭受攻击:比如DDoS攻击,就是用海量的垃圾访问请求把你的服务器“冲垮”,导致正常用户无法访问。或者网站被黑客入侵,植入了恶意代码。
*被墙或服务商屏蔽:如果你的服务器IP地址因为某些原因被防火墙屏蔽,或者你的网站内容违反了主机服务商的规定,他们也可能会暂停你的服务。
*流量用超了:有些主机套餐对月流量有限制,如果你的网站视频、图片多,突然火了,流量可能一下就用完了,导致网站被暂停。
聊了这么多可能的原因,说实话,我觉得对于新手朋友来说,最重要的不是记住每一个技术细节,而是建立一套自己的排查习惯和备份意识。
1.养成备份的习惯,而且是异地备份!这绝对是金科玉律。在你对网站做任何重大改动(比如更新核心、主题、插件)之前,一定要先手动备份一次。很多主机商提供一键备份功能,也可以使用专门的备份插件。把备份文件下载到自己的电脑或者网盘里。这样,一旦出问题,你就有“后悔药”可以吃。
2.善用“侦探工具”。除了前面提到的让朋友帮忙访问,还可以用一些在线工具,比如“网站能否正常访问检测”工具,它可以模拟全球不同地区的访问,帮你判断是不是区域性故障。
3.改动要循序渐进。不要一次性更新所有的插件和主题。更新一个,观察一会儿网站是否正常,没问题再更新下一个。这样一旦出问题,你立刻就知道“凶手”是谁。
4.保持冷静,善用搜索。当你遇到一个错误代码(比如常见的“500内部服务器错误”、“建立数据库连接时出错”)时,别慌,把这个错误代码完整地复制下来,贴到搜索引擎里搜一下。你遇到过的坑,百分之九十九已经有前人踩过并且留下了解决方案,多看几篇教程,自己就能摸索着解决。
说到底,独立站打不开这事儿,确实烦人,但把它看作一个学习和了解网站运行机制的机会,心态会好很多。每一次解决问题的过程,都会让你对网站的掌控力更强一点。别怕出错,重要的是知道怎么把它找回来。你的网站就像你的一个小作品,有点小毛病,亲手把它修好,那份成就感,也挺棒的,对吧?
版权说明:立即拨打咨询热线,获取专业的建站方案和优惠报价
